Poker Player From Nottingham Becomes Poker Millionaire

Julian Thew

We have all had to work a job at some point or another in life where we feel that we are working for nothing other than to cover the bills and a dad of three who lives in Nottingham, United Kingdom has managed to break that routine through his decision to play professional poker.

Julian Thew used to work as a decorator and delivery driver within Nottinghamshire opted to leave his job in a bid to try to make a living at the gambling tables and his decision has certainly paid off.

The amateur turned professional poker player recently managed to take his poker winnings to a huge £1.7 million.

Although the newly turned professional player has cashed more than £1.7 million in poker winnings, Julian Thew has revealed that he is hungry to improve on that figure, setting his sights on further success within the next up and coming PokerStars UK and Ireland Poker Tour (UKIPT) rolls into his home town of Nottingham.

The tournament is set to attract a huge selection of poker hopefuls and with a large total prize pool of $100,000 up for grabs over the 5 day tournament series, its not surprise that participation figures are expect to be higher than the last installment of the UKIPT.

The tournament selection offers a tournament for every player, with the likes of women only tournaments also being ready to be made available, paving the way for a number of female amateur poker players to make a name for themselves within the poker community.
